4. Wireless setup
This section is only relevant if wireless functionality
is available on your Platinum. The LED
indicates if wireless functionality is enabled.
Step 1:
To set up the wireless connection between your
computer and the Platinum you may need the SSID
and WPA key of the Platinum. The SSID is the name
of the wireless network. The WPA key is the pass-
word needed for your secured wireless network. The
default SSID and the WPA key are printed on the label
on the rear of your Platinum and on the seperate
labels included in the package.

Step 2:
(Instructions for Windows Vista / Windows 7; for
other operating systems please contact your service
provider)
• Go to “Start” at the bottom left corner and
click on “Control Panel”.
• The Control Panel window will appear. Click
on “View Network Status and Tasks” at the
“Network and Internet” category.
• The Network Connections window will appear.
Click on the “Connect to a network”.
• Show “Wireless” and select the network (SSID)
that is printed on the label.
• If requested press the WPS button on your
Platinum. Alternatively you can connect using
the WPA key that is printed on the label.
• Your connection is now operational. Open your
web browser and verify that your connection
is working. If your connection is not working,
please refer to the troubleshooting section.
• After installation you can manually change the
SSID and WPA key, by using the web-interface
of the Platinum.
